Key Moments
Markers derived by PSI from the transcript: the creator did not define chapters.
- Introduction: Earth is unique among inner planets in having a large moon; the Earth-Moon system as a double planet.
- Discussion of tides: the Sun contributes about a third of tidal effects; the Moon's role in tidal pools and the origin of life.
- Effects on ocean nutrient distribution and potential dead zones without sufficient tides.
- Earth's rotation would be faster (8-10 hours) without the Moon, affecting circadian rhythms and agriculture.
- The Moon stabilizes Earth's axial tilt; without it, extreme wobbles would cause unstable polar caps and climate variability.
- Other effects: reflected light heating, ocean currents, and the Moon's influence on early Earth's salinity and magnetic field.
- Scenario of sudden Moon disappearance: impact on nocturnal predators, coastal life, and long-term instability.
- Conclusion: Life on Earth may be in symbiosis with the Moon; without it, life might never have arisen.
